Millennium Place www.strathcona.ca/millenniumplace Group Visits Spontaneous use allows guests to come play, swim, skate or exercise daily from 9 a.m. – 9 p.m., any day of the week. To ensure enjoyment for all guests, school group guidelines have been created outlining that large student groups of more than 20 should be divided into smaller groups and rotate through the various spontaneous use activities. When planning your group visit please note the wave pool is very popular and capacities can be reached at any time. Planning your visit to Millennium Place Arrival procedures • Please plan to arrive at the Southeast entrance at Millennium Place. We ask that a teacher/ leader inform the front desk of arrival and have students line up in an orderly fashion to receive wristbands for access to the amenities. • Groups are required to pay at the front desk by MasterCard, Visa, American Express, Cheque or Debit. Please note that we do not invoice. Spontaneous Use Amenities Included with your wristband Paris Jewellers Gymnasium • Designed for all ages • The Paris Jewellers gymnasium is open for activities such as floor hockey, basketball and badminton. We supply plastic hockey sticks, pucks, badminton racquets, birdies, and basketballs for your convenience. • Footwear: Clean indoor shoes must be worn at all times. Gymamazium • Designed for ages 8-15 • Located in our gymnasium, this interactive indoor playground is a popular attraction. • Footwear: Clean indoor shoes must be worn at all time. Youth Lounge • Designed for ages 12-17 • The Youth Lounge features Xbox and Wii gaming systems with a large playing screen, pool table, foosball table, arcade game system and more! • Footwear: Clean indoor shoes must be worn at all time. The McKay Team Aquatics Centre • Designed for all ages (children 8 years of age and under must be accompanied by a responsible person over the age of 14. Maximum of 3 children to 1 supervisor. This person must stay within arms reach of each child) • Our wave pool is open for spontaneous use with waves starting at 10 a.m. daily. The wave pool includes a lazy river, tree house water play feature, tipping bucket and more! Hot tub, steam room and sauna are also available. • The lap pool is open from 5:15 a.m. – 11:00 p.m. daily. with a minimum of three lanes available for spontanious swimming, unless there is an event. • Lifejackets, water toys, flutter boards, flippers and tubes are available free of charge on the pool deck. The McKay Team Aquatics Centre closes for annual maintenance every year in September. • Footwear: Outdoor footwear is not allowed on the deck at any time. Please remove footwear at entrance to the change rooms and secure your footwear in a locker. Edu-tainment Centre (Indoor Playground) • Designed for 2-12 years olds (children under the age of 6 must be accompanied and actively supervised by a responsible person over the age of 14). • Some of the highlights here include a rock climbing wall, slides, monkey bars, and an interactive tree house. We have an infant zone designed for younger children with small mats and play toys. • Footwear: Indoor shoes or socks. No bare feet. Climbing shoes may be worn on the climbing wall. Pure Orthodontics Pond • Designed for all ages • Skate rentals are available for an additional fee. Please note that we do not provide helmets, but we do strongly recommend them for all skaters. Skate aides, grippers, and sledges are available at no charge. • Footwear: Skates only. Shoes are allowed when assisting someone learning to skate. Shoe grippers are available and recommended. It is strongly recommended that anyone on the ice surface wear a helmet. To ensure a proper fit, it is suggested that skaters bring their own personal helmet for use. Indoor Soccer Fields • Designed for all ages • We have two indoor soccer fields which are available to the public for use when they are not privately booked. The turf is generally in place during the months of October through March. Sport court replaces the turf from April to October for ball hockey and lacrosse. Availability of the fields is dependent upon events and bookings. • Footwear: Indoor running shoes, indoor soccer shoes (no outdoor shoes permitted) Rentable areas not included in the wristbands The following areas are available for rent to give your group exclusive use. General Information Lunch Area We have an open foyer with tables and chairs for your group to enjoy their snack or lunch. Concession services are available, and vending machines are located throughout the building. Storing Belongings Coin operated lockers are available, or you may bring your own locks that must be removed by the end of the day. Small lockers are one quarter, medium lockers are two quarters and large lockers are a loonie. It is highly recommended that all personal belongings be locked up. Free tokens are available from the front desk for wallet and purse sized lockers. What to do if capacities are reached? We work with all groups to share the space with the general public. In the event that safety capacities are reached in any area, a ticket system is implemented in order to coordinate everyone’s access to the facility. To help keep capacities from being reached, we ask that larger groups split into smaller groups and rotate throughout the activities in the facility. Additional details and important information • Teacher or parent supervisors must actively supervise students at all times. Visual supervision of the students is expected in all spontaneous use areas. • For safety purposes, when in the wave pool, children 8 years of age and younger must be accompanied by someone who is 14 years of age or older, and must always stay within arms reach. There is a maximum ratio of 3 children to 1 adult. • Skate rentals are available for an additional fee. Helmets for skating are not mandatory but are highly recommended. Children are required to bring their own helmet, as we do not have helmet rentals. • Admission fees are applicable to supervisors who are in the water with the children, skating, or participating in other sports. • Millennium Place does not accept school or group bookings for the exclusive use of any of the spontaneous amenities (wave pool, edu-tainment centre, gymnasium, leisure ice during regular hours). This means that groups share activities with the general public. • We recommend that groups exceeding 20 split into smaller groups and use the amenities simultaneously. • The following areas are food free zones: the edu-tainment centre, gymnasium, wave pool, soccer fields, and ice surfaces. Millennium Place has a large lobby equipped with tables and a food service area for your convenience.
